How do I find the R file in Android?
It will be located in the app/build/generated/source/r… directory.12 Answers
- Open your project.
- Go to the build path of your module.
- Open the file outputs/apk/debug/app-name-debug.
- Choose your classes.
- Look at the area placed below and go to the full path of your package.
- You can see all byte-encoded resource classes.
Table of Contents
How do I open an R Java file in Android?
In Android Studio, go to the project window (usually in the left side panel):
- Right click on the node, app.
- Click “Show in Explorer”. This will open the actual directory/location of your project.
- The path to the R.java file in this directory is as follows: app/build/generated/source/r/debug/com/sg/calculator.
How to generate r file in Android Studio?
Android R.java is a file automatically generated by aapt (Android Asset Packaging Tool) that contains resource IDs for all resources in the res/ directory. xml, the corresponding component id is automatically created in this file. This id can be used in the activity’s source file to perform any action on the component.
What is r in Android Studio?
R is a class that contains the definitions of all the resources of a particular application package. It’s in the application package namespace. For example, if you say in your manifest that your package name is com. foo bar, an R class is generated with the symbols of all its resources in com.
What is the name of the folder that contains the R Java file?
build directory
The directory name gen means generated. The gen directory contains R. java.
What is the dx tool?
The dx tool allows you to generate Android bytecode from . class files. The tool converts target files and/or directories to Dalvik executable (.dex) format files, so they can be run in the Android environment.
What is r in Android Kotlin?
R is a class automatically generated by the tools that build your project. It will contain identifiers of the XML resource files. For example, there will be one constant for each resource file and for each ID in each XML layout.
How to remove restrictions in Android R?
Android app
- Login to your account.
- At the top right, tap More .
- Select Settings. General.
- Turn restricted mode on or off.
Can R run on Android?
This app effectively gives you a complete Linux environment within Android, without rooting your device. It just works. You can use it not only to run R on your phone, but also Python or any other GNU/Linux compatible command line tool.
How are layouts placed in Android?
Layout files are stored in “res->layout” in the android app. When we open the app resource we find the Android app layout files. We can create layouts in the XML file or Java file programmatically. First, we’ll create a new Android Studio project called “Sample Layouts”.
How to rectify package error in Android Studio?
Click Build —> Clean Project or Build —> Rebuild Project on the top menu bar of Android Studio. This will allow Android Studio to regenerate R.java again. It will clear the cache and include all the newly added resources.
Why am I getting a Your error in Android Studio?
In Android Studio, the letter R represents resources, and this error occurs because the build process is unable to sync resources with your project. In other words, this error occurs when Android Studio is unable to generate your R.java file correctly.
Where to find r.java file in Android Studio?
I use Android Studio 2.3.3. The R.java file is shown in the image above. At the top left, there is a selection list. Select option [proyecto] so you can see all the folders and files. Sorry for the OP. I seriously doubt that you asked for a screenshot of the actual R file.
How to find are file in Android Studio 2020?
R is a Generated class in Android and after building your project this class will be created first, build your project after that click 4 times on the switch button on your keyboard. in the new windows look for class ‘R’ and in the list look for class R.java, that’s it. Thanks for contributing an answer to Stack Overflow!